Output 0c53989ec50864e33dbabbb393bfb3a005bd63794160f975e602c076f33fdfa4:0

value
10648520
script pubkey
OP_0 OP_PUSHBYTES_20 ecefca77d4796742fd0bb9c6005bad444bf57211
address
bc1qanhu5a7509n59lgth8rqqkadg39l2us3muvwqk
transaction
0c53989ec50864e33dbabbb393bfb3a005bd63794160f975e602c076f33fdfa4